Date | 6th September 1938 | |
To Rm{William Robotham - Chief Engineer}/RC.{R. Childs} 6092 BY/RD.4/B.6.9.38. REGULATORS. We have obtained from Messrs. Lucas the identification number by which the new 2 1/2 turn regulator is to be known, i.e. B.2.CS/11. Included with the correspondence is a copy of their laboratory reports Nos. 6715 and E.4789 which give the following output figures. Open Circuit Operating Voltage (Cold) 15.8 - 16.3 volts. Output at | 13 volts. | 13.5 volts. | 15.5 volts. Cold. | 16.7 - 19.6 amps. | 13.8 - 16.7 | 3.2 - 5.9 Hot. | 20.4 - 23.2 amps. | 17.4 - 20.3 | 6.6 - 7.4 [Handwritten note] We agree with these figures Rm{William Robotham - Chief Engineer}/Rc{R. Childs} The above figures are all lower than those given on our detail drawing D.55030 which were obtained from the Expl. Dept. and are as follows :- Open Circuit Operating Voltage (Cold) 16.4 - 16.9 volts. Output at | 13.5 volts. | 15.5 volts. Cold. | 15 - 19 amps. | 8 - 12 amps. Hot. | 17 - 21 amps. | 10 - 14 amps. Owing to the discrepancies between the two sets of figures, we hand you herewith 2 regulators B.2.CJ/11 taken from the first production batch, for you to test and report on, to enable a specification to be drawn up.
